A Holistic Approach to Rehabilitation & Performance
Many first responder rehab programs, like the one pioneered at Ohio State, began as post-injury recovery plans but have evolved to include preventive conditioning, strength training, and mental resilience strategies. At Ares Physical Therapy, we take the same comprehensive approach, offering:

Injury rehab & post-surgical recovery

Tactical athlete conditioning (strength, mobility, endurance)

Pain management & injury prevention

Collaboration with nutritionists, mental health professionals, and orthopedic specialists

The Ares Physical Therapy Difference
We don’t just treat injuries, we rebuild strength, confidence, and readiness. Our phased system includes:
Rehab (reducing pain, restoring movement)
Reconditioning (sport/tactical-specific drills)
Resilience training (preventing future injuries)
